Bloch 01-30-2004 10:44 AM

Quote:

Originally Posted by PranK
damn, 41 pages... any tutorials on creating custom side blocks?

Well, I give it a try:
First, define how many custom blocks you want to have within the vbioptions-panel. Save this and then you can assign the new boxes wherever you want them.

To fill content into your custom boxes, go into the admin panel from your VBulletin board:
Go into style manager, and then into "Edit Templates"
Under custom templates, you should see "Vbindex" and further down the list your custom boxes: "vbindex_customblock_1", "vbindex_customblock_2", etc.

Edit these (all within the template editor in VBulletin).

Hope this helps. Took time for me to figure it out, but now works flawless.
